A 5.3-million-year-old deep-sea whale necropolis in the Diamantina Zone
Abstract Whale falls are biodiversity oases at seabeds1,2,3,4,5,6, yet their record from the oceans has remained sparse and fragmentary6,7. Here we report the discovery of a vast whale necropolis in the Diamantina Zone (4,616- to 7,001-m depth), extending about 1,200 km along the sea floor of the southeastern Indian Ocean. This area has a deep and extensive accumulation comprising five modern natural whale-fall communities and 476 fossil cetaceans recorded.

Unlikely material behind Whitsundays artist's fashion collection
Whitsundays artist creates fish leather from seafood waste Sun 31 May 2026 at 7:02am In the front yard of her home, nestled in the picturesque Whitsundays, Felicity Chapman strips the last pieces of flesh and sinew from a strip of barramundi skin. "You want to keep the tension really tight, otherwise it just tears," Ms Chapman said. Swapping between a large-handled knife and a scalpel for the more precise work, she uses a process learned entirely through trial and error.
